Released February 23rd, 1996, 'Subterfuge' stars Matt McColm, Amanda Pays, Jason Gould, Richard Brake The R movie has a runtime of about 1 hr 35 min, and received a user score of 63 (out of 100) on TMDb, which compiled reviews from 3 respected users.
Want to know what the movie's about? Here's the plot: "Scuba-diver turned beach-bum Jonathan Slade is forced back into his previous milieu - the world of international espionage - in order to retrieve Black Boxes from an American jetliner that crashed under mysterious circumstances into the Black Sea. With his computer-hacker younger brother, Slade travels to a resort on the Russian-Turkish border to begin his quest. To his surprise and dismay, he's now joined by another secret agent, a beautiful but highly-skilled woman named Alex. As they begin diving in search of the downed jetliner, Slade and Alex begin to suspect they're being manipulated by higher-ups who may not be committed to American interests." .
